Disability shower installation services involve the customization and setup of accessible shower areas designed to meet specific mobility needs. These services typically include the removal of existing shower fixtures, the installation of walk-in or roll-in showers, and the addition of features such as gr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options. The goal is to create a safe, functional, and comfortable bathing environment that accommodates individuals with limited mobility, balance issues, or other physical challenges. Professionals ensure that the installation adheres to safety standards and is tailored to the user’s specific requirements.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with mobility impairments, such as difficulty entering or exiting traditional showers, risk of slips and falls, and the inability to comfortably stand for extended periods. By installing accessible showers, property owners can reduce the risk of accidents and promote independence for those with physical limitations. Additionally, these installations can prevent the need for more extensive modifications or assisted bathing solutions, providing a practical and long-term solution for accessible living spaces.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while custom features can increase the price.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with standard options starting around $300 and premium, accessible designs costing up to $2,000. Factors influencing costs include flooring, walls, and accessibility features selected for the installation.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for disability shower installation typically fall between $500 and $2,000. The total depends on the project's scope, including any necessary modifications to existing plumbing or structural elements.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, customization, or accessibility accessories,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more. It’s advisable to contact local pros for precise quotes tailored to specific installation requ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es customizing the shower area to accommodate accessibility needs, ensuring proper plumbing connections, and possibly adding grab bars or seating, depending on individual requirements.

How long does a disability shower installation usually take? The duration varies based on the complexity of the project, but most installations can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.

Are there specific features to consider for a disability shower? Features such as low-threshold entry, non-slip flooring, grab bars, and built-in seating are common considerations for accessible shower installations.

Can existing showers be modified for accessibility? Yes, many local pros offer modifications like installing grab bars, replacing the shower base, or adding seating to improve accessibility without a full replacement.
